The QFE-2320-0-80BLGA-TR-0B-0, manufactured by Qualcomm, is an RF Front-End Module (FEM) designed for cellular applications. It likely integrates multiple components such as power amplifiers, filters, and switches to provide a complete RF front-end solution for mobile devices.
